The City of Maricopa included more than 50 potential capital improvement projects in its 2020-24 fiscal planning, some with higher priority than others. City Manager Rick Horst unveiled the tentative budget in May, showing it is filled with $33.95 million in capital projects. Many of those have been on the city’s “wish list” for years.
